✨ What a Safe Environment Looks Like ✨

A safe environment isn’t just about physical space β€” it’s about how people feel when they are in it. Everyone deserves to be in a place where they feel secure, respected, and supported.

βœ… Respect – People listen to you and value what you say.
βœ… Trust – You can be yourself without fear of judgment or harm.
βœ… Boundaries – Rules and expectations are clear and followed fairly.
βœ… Support – You have someone to turn to if you need help
βœ… Inclusion – Everyone feels welcomed and valued.
βœ… Protection – No bullying, no harm, no unsafe behavior.

🌱 When people feel safe, they are free to grow, learn, and build positive connections. A safe environment builds strong communities, healthy relationships, and brighter futures.
